← Back to the blog
Guide

Add Booking System to Website Quickly: 10‑Minute Setup Guide

Published 2026-06-03 · 5 min read

Adding a booking system to your website quickly can feel like a race against time—especially when prospects are watching the clock. A clunky calendar or a broken checkout step sends visitors straight to the competitor’s page. The good news? With the right widget, you can go from zero to live in under ten minutes, keeping the sales funnel tight and the calendar full. Below is a step‑by‑step guide that walks you through preparation, installation, and optimization so you can start booking appointments before your coffee even cools.

Why a Fast Booking Integration Matters

First impressions are decisive. Studies from 2026 show that 70 % of small‑business websites lose a booking when the checkout flow exceeds three seconds. Speed isn’t just a nice‑to‑have; it’s a conversion engine. A rapid, seamless booking experience cuts drop‑off, boosts average order value, and signals professionalism to a consumer base that now expects instant results.

Beyond conversion, a fast integration saves money. Custom development projects in 2026 average $12,800 and take six weeks, whereas a plug‑and‑play widget can be live in minutes for a $499 one‑time fee. That difference translates into 12 hours/week of staff time that can be redirected to client care or marketing. In short, a swift booking setup aligns with modern consumer expectations, reduces development costs, and puts you ahead of the 35 % of competitors still using manual scheduling.

Ready to add Smart Booking to your website?

PlugMySite installs Smart Booking on your existing site in 2 days — no rebuild needed. One-time $299, no monthly fees. 20% deposit to start.

📅 Get Smart Booking — $299 → 📅 Book a free call →

Preparing Your Calendar and Service List

Before you paste a line of code, gather the data that will power the widget. Start with a master spreadsheet that lists every service, its duration, and price point. Include variations such as “30‑minute consultation – $75” and “Full‑day workshop – $1,200.” Clear naming conventions prevent duplicate entries and make the UI intuitive for customers.

Next, map staff availability. Export each team member’s schedule from Google Calendar or a similar tool, then add buffer times for travel, cleanup, or prep. A 15‑minute buffer between back‑to‑back appointments reduces overbooking by 28 % and gives staff a realistic pacing. Finally, decide on cancellation rules—whether you allow a 24‑hour grace period or require a deposit. Having these policies written down ensures the widget’s settings match your business model from day one.

🔥Limited Sale: $599 for Website + Payments + Booking

Get a complete business website with Stripe checkout and Smart Booking included — normally $1,499.

New site + Payments · $599 → Upgrade my site · $599 →

One-time fee. No monthly charges. Payments + booking auto-bundled. 5-day delivery.

PlugMySite Booking Widget Installation Walkthrough

  1. Log in to the PlugMySite dashboard and navigate to the “Add Booking Widget” tab.
  2. Select your service categories from the dropdown; the system will auto‑populate the list you prepared.
  3. Configure availability by linking the staff Google Calendars you exported earlier.
  4. Choose payment options (Stripe, PayPal, or PlugMySite Pay) and paste the corresponding API keys.
  5. Generate the snippet – a single line of JavaScript that looks like .

Copy this line and insert it into the section of any page where you want the booking button to appear. If you run WordPress, Joomla, or Squarespace, the PlugMySite CMS plugin lets you paste the snippet into a “Custom Code” block without touching the source files. After saving, refresh the page; the sleek booking button should now be visible, ready to accept appointments in under 2 seconds.

Syncing with Google Calendar and Payment Options

Authorize PlugMySite to access your Google Calendar by clicking “Connect” and signing in with the same Google account your staff uses. The widget establishes a two‑way sync, meaning any changes you make in Google—like a sudden day‑off—are instantly reflected on the front‑end calendar, preventing double‑bookings. Real‑time sync reduces manual admin by 8 hours/week for a typical service business.

Payment integration follows a similar simple flow. In the dashboard, select your gateway:

Enter the API keys provided by the gateway, toggle “Capture payment on booking,” and enable automatic confirmation emails. Customers receive a receipt within seconds, and you get a real‑time notification in Slack or via email, keeping cash flow visible from the first click.

Testing the Booking Flow

A proper test run catches hidden glitches before real customers see them. Open a private browser window (or use incognito mode) and schedule a dummy appointment using a fake email address. Verify each step:

Finally, resize the browser to mimic mobile devices. The widget should remain fully responsive, loading in under 2 seconds on a 4G connection. A quick audit of these elements guarantees a smooth experience across devices and reduces the risk of abandoned bookings.

🔍 Free AI-Powered Site Audit

Not sure what your website needs? Our AI scans your site in 30 seconds and shows you exactly what's missing — completely free.

Scan my website free →

Tips for Reducing No‑Shows and Cancellations

  1. Require a deposit or full payment at the time of booking. Data from 2026 shows a 45 % drop in no‑shows when a $20 deposit is collected.
  2. Send automated reminders—a text or email 24 hours before, followed by a final push 1 hour prior. Reminder click‑through rates now average 68 %, prompting most clients to confirm or reschedule.
  3. Enforce a clear cancellation policy with a 24‑hour grace period and a 50 % fee for last‑minute changes. Transparent rules reduce disputes and set expectations upfront.
  4. Offer a “Reschedule” button in the reminder email. Allowing an easy switch cuts cancellations by 30 % because clients choose a new slot instead of dropping the appointment entirely.

Implementing these tactics turns a simple booking widget into a revenue‑protecting system that keeps your calendar filled and your staff utilized efficiently.

Next Steps: Boost Conversions with PlugMySite’s Full Suite

Now that you’ve added a booking system in minutes, consider layering additional PlugMySite features. An AI concierge chatbot can answer FAQs instantly, trimming support tickets by 40 %. SEO tools push your service pages to the top of search results, driving a 25 % increase in organic traffic within the first month. Bundling website, payments, and booking for $599 (normally $1,499) gives you a complete digital storefront without a rebuild, and the one‑time fee eliminates recurring costs.

Ready to add Online Checkout to your website?

PlugMySite installs Online Checkout on your existing site in 2 days — no rebuild needed. One-time $599, no monthly fees. 20% deposit to start.

💳 Get Online Checkout — $599 → 📅 Book a free call →

Frequently Asked Questions

Q: How long does it really take to add a booking system to my website?

With PlugMySite’s one‑line widget, you can go live in under 10 minutes after preparing your service list. The entire process—from dashboard setup to testing—fits into a single coffee break.

Q: Do I need any coding skills to install the widget?

No. The installation is a simple copy‑paste of a JavaScript snippet, or you can use our CMS plugin for WordPress, Squarespace, and Joomla, which requires no code at all.

Q: Can I sync the booking system with my existing Google Calendar?

Yes, PlugMySite offers native two‑way sync with Google Calendar, keeping availability up to date automatically and eliminating manual entry errors.

Q: What payment methods are supported?

Stripe, PayPal, and PlugMySite Pay are supported, allowing credit cards, Apple Pay, and Google Pay. You can switch between gateways from the dashboard without redeploying code.

🔥Limited Sale: $599 for Website + Payments + Booking

Get a complete business website with Stripe checkout and Smart Booking included — normally $1,499.

New site + Payments · $599 → Upgrade my site · $599 →

One-time fee. No monthly charges. Payments + booking auto-bundled. 5-day delivery.

🚀 More features you can add

Each one plugs into your site independently. One-time fee, no subscriptions.

📅Smart BookingSelf-service scheduling with calendar sync, reminders, and optional deposits.
$299⚡ 2 days
💳Online CheckoutAccept credit cards, Apple Pay, Google Pay via Stripe. One-time + subscriptions.
$599⚡ 2 days
📊KPI DashboardReal-time business dashboard — revenue, conversions, sources, all in one view.
$799⚡ 3 days
📧Email MarketingNewsletter signup, drip campaigns, segmentation, and automation sequences.
$599⚡ 3 days
🔍 Free site audit → 📅 Book a free call → See all 20+ features →
Want this on your site?

PlugMySite installs upgrades like this on your existing website in days — no rebuild, no migration.

See pricing & bundles →

Keep reading

Browse all articles →

How to Add Online Payments to Your Website (Without Rebuilding It)

Accepting card payments on an existing site no longer means a full rebuild. Here is the fast, low-risk way to add checkout in days.

How to Improve Your Website SEO: A Practical Guide for Small Businesses

SEO is not magic. It is a short list of fixable technical and content issues. Here is what actually moves rankings for a small site.

Add Online Booking to an Existing Website Without Rebuilding

Stop trading emails to schedule appointments. A booking widget drops into any site and lets customers book themselves.

← Back to all articles
🔍
Upgrade my site Paste your URL — we scan speed, SEO, and missing features, then build your upgrade plan. Scan free →
Build a new site Pick a template, add features like booking or payments, and launch in 3-7 days. Browse templates →